Can unpack an old cvf game file but not a new version of it

Extraction and unpacking of game archives and compression, encryption, obfuscation, decoding of unknown files
f0xma
Posts: 3
Joined: Tue Jul 13, 2021 1:56 pm

Can unpack an old cvf game file but not a new version of it

Post by f0xma »

Basically I saved my old game client to Metal Assault from 2012 when it was hosted by Aeria Games, come to learn that I can successfully unpack it all with offzip and extract the sounds, graphics and some readable text.
https://www.mediafire.com/file/vfycbw26 ... G.cvf/file

I decided to try my hands at it again with the 2016 re-release of the game client hosted by Warp Portal, but come to find I can't unpack it, I only get errors. I'm not sure, but it might have something to do with it being attached to Steam, because I can't unpack the EU version either and that is also attached to Steam, but I can extract older international versions of the game client that have no connection to Steam just as Aeria Games version didn't.
https://www.mediafire.com/file/scgf0cq2 ... P.cvf/file

Can anyone give me a hand to figure out how to extract this newer cvf file. It's actually smaller than the older one, but it contains more graphics and updated English translations. So I would like to get them if possible.

Any help is appreciated. I'm really new at this, I'm glad I tried with the AG version first, atleast I know I'm on the right track.
grandshot
Posts: 42
Joined: Mon Jun 07, 2021 8:20 pm

Re: Can unpack an old cvf game file but not a new version of it

Post by grandshot »

In old version, files inside CVF compressed by ZLIB.
Compression method of the new version is unknown.
f0xma
Posts: 3
Joined: Tue Jul 13, 2021 1:56 pm

Re: Can unpack an old cvf game file but not a new version of it

Post by f0xma »

Yeah I tried using offzip to figure out what the new compression method is, but I got nothing. It tells me to try a different method but it doesn't bare any fruit. Any suggestion?
f0xma
Posts: 3
Joined: Tue Jul 13, 2021 1:56 pm

Re: Can unpack an old cvf game file but not a new version of it

Post by f0xma »

I come to find out this was previously addressed, as posted here viewtopic.php?f=9&t=2609&hilit=cvf

I used QuickBMS with the mentioned script (http://aluigi.org/bms/sfilesystem.bms) and I was able to deflate this unknown compression cvf game file.

While offzip couldn't accomplish the task this time, QuickBMS was able too. So now I have two apps to utilize.